Many divers use these rings to secure accessories such as gauges, cameras, flashlights, or even mesh bags to their BCDs, ensuring that important tools are always within reach and safely attached. The right scuba diving ring can also be used for attaching marker buoys, reels, or slates, streamlining your setup and minimizing the risk of losing valuable equipment in strong currents or low-visibility conditions. When selecting a scuba ring, material and construction are key considerations. Durability is paramount, as gear exposed to saltwater and repeated use must resist corrosion and maintain strength over time. Many divers prefer stainless steel for its blend of toughness and rust resistance, especially for those who dive frequently or in challenging environments. Size and shape also matter: smaller rings are ideal for light accessories, while larger or oval-shaped rings can accommodate bulkier items or provide easier handling with gloved hands. For families or instructors, the diving ring is also a classic choice for pool games and training exercises, helping new swimmers build confidence and underwater skills in a fun, interactive way.
